Ashfield Boys and Burwood Girls High School Catchment Map Added

Two in one deal here, both Ashfield Boys and Burwood Girls have exact same catchment area. They kinda function like a Coed school in this sense and covering a specific zone. I remember back in the old days, you do get offered option of going to a Coed school even if you are zoned for boys or girls high school. The school office probably can help clear the details up if you are interested in that.

The most common name used by NSW Department of Education is called “catchment” which refer to that students resides in particular area are guaranteed position in specific schools. When discussed from prospective of a particular school is often referred as one of the following term.

  • School Zone
  • School intake area
  • School catchment
